🔑 This might be a hot take, but that’s why you’re here. Notion is known to many for it’s note taking abilities. Much less known is it’s strongly underrated, no nonense CRM. In essence Notion is a no code, web application for note taking that offers tons of templates. In it’s free version, the CRM templates can be easily obtained, modified and shared with up to 10 people. Notion also offers other CRM templated designed by outside designers that can be obtained for a fee. While notion allows for some automation, namely messaging via Slack and email, automation is also it’s biggest limitation. Unlike many other “real” CRMs, you can’t tag your emails nor are there many of the other convenient integrations available. One integration, that is very appealing for solopreneurs and startups is that with Tally.so. Tally.so offers the possibility to capture clients and their data via forms/questionnaires. Upon completion the data from the forms will be synced to Notion.
